Lake Velence is Hungary's third-largest natural lake, situated at the foot of the Velence Mountains between Budapest and Lake Balaton. Covering 26 square kilometers, the lake has an average depth of only 1.5 meters, allowing its waters to warm up rapidly to 26-28 degrees Celsius during summer. The southwestern part of the lake houses the Dinnyés Reedbed Nature Reserve, an internationally recognized bird sanctuary and breeding ground for waterfowl. Significant portions of the lake are covered by reeds, which support a rich fish population and a highly diverse ecosystem. Geologically, the lake basin was formed 12,000 to 15,000 years ago through subsidence, with its water supply primarily provided by precipitation and the Császár Stream. The water's high mineral content is considered refreshing, and the surrounding towns are popular resorts for tourism, sailing, and various water sports.

Best time to visit & climate
The most pleasant time to visit is Jun–Aug.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°C | -1 | 1 | 6 | 12 | 17 | 21 | 24 | 23 | 18 | 12 | 6 | 0 |
| Rain mm | 37 | 41 | 39 | 34 | 63 | 67 | 62 | 60 | 59 | 50 | 42 | 42 |
